About V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ML
- V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ML is a liquid medication that is used to prevent nausea and vomiting caused by chemotherapy, radiation therapy, and surgery. V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ML It belongs to a class of drugs known as 5-HT3 receptor antagonists, which work by blocking the action of a chemical called serotonin, which is responsible for triggering nausea and vomiting. V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ML This medication is available by prescription only, and is generally administered orally or intravenously. The recommended dose for adults is 8 mg orally or 4 mg intravenously every 8 hours as needed.

How V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ML Works
- V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ML works by blocking the action of a chemical in the body called serotonin.
- V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ML In certain situations, such as after chemotherapy or radiation therapy, the body may produce high levels of serotonin, which can cause nausea and vomiting. V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ML works by blocking serotonin receptors in the brain and gut, reducing the activity of serotonin and thereby reducing the likelihood of nausea and vomiting.
- V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ML is a selective serotonin receptor antagonist that specifically blocks serotonin receptors, reducing nausea and vomiting without affecting other neurotransmitters or receptors.
- V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ML works by targeting the cause of nausea and vomiting in the brain. Take it as directed by a healthcare professional, being aware of potential side effects and medication interactions.
Dosage of V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ML
- Dosage for children: The recommended dosage of V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ML for children may vary based on their age and weight. It is typically prescribed as an oral tablet, orally disintegrating tablet, or oral solution. Common dosages for children range from 0.15 to 0.3 mg/kg per dose, with a maximum daily dose of 16 mg.
- Dosage for adults: For adults, the typical dosage of V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ML ranges from 8 to 16 mg, depending on the condition being treated. It can be administered as an oral tablet, orally disintegrating tablet, or intravenous injection. The specific dosage and duration of treatment should be determined by a healthcare professional based on individual needs and medical condition.

Frequently asked questions about V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ML
V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ML is used to prevent nausea and vomiting caused by chemotherapy, radiation therapy, surgery, and other medical conditions.
V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ML is usually taken by mouth as a tablet or liquid, or given as an injection by a healthcare provider.
The dosing and frequency of V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ML will depend on the individual patient's needs, medical condition, and other factors. It is important to follow the instructions provided by your healthcare provider.
Common side effects of V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ML include headache, fatigue, constipation, diarrhea, dizziness, sleepiness, dry mouth, blurred vision, and flushing.
In some cases, V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ML can cause more serious side effects, such as changes in heart rate, chest pain, shortness of breath, severe or persistent headache, vision changes or loss of vision, and signs of an allergic reaction.
V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ML should only be taken during pregnancy or breastfeeding if recommended by a healthcare provider. Pregnant or breastfeeding women should discuss the risks and benefits of the medication with their doctor.
Yes, V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ML can interact with other medications, including certain antidepressants and medications that affect heart rhythm. Patients should inform their healthcare provider about all medications they are taking before starting VOMIKIND INJCTION 2 ML.
